Mongolian

Adjective

их (ih) (Mongolian spelling ᠶᠡᠺᠡ (yege))

  1. big, considerable, grand, great
  2. hearty, jolly, prodigious, umpteen

Adverb

их (ih)

  1. greatly, heartily, immensely, exceedingly
  2. many, more, most, much,

Russian

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): [ix]
  • (dated or regional) IPA(key): [jix]

Pronoun

их (ix) m, f, n

  1. (possessive) their, theirs (invariable, singular and plural, all genders); genitive plural of они́ (oní)
    Где их кни́га?Gde ix kníga?Where is their book?
    Я уже́ ви́дел их кни́гу.Ja užé vídel ix knígu.I've already seen their book.

Pronoun

их (ix) m, f, n

  1. accusative plural of они́ (oní); them
    Она́ их ви́дит.Oná ix vídit.She sees them.

See also

Synonyms

  • (possessive pronoun): и́хний (íxnij) (non-standard, colloquial, declinable)

Serbo-Croatian

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/ix/

Pronoun

их (Latin spelling ih)

  1. of them (clitic genitive plural of о̑н (he))
  2. of them (clitic genitive plural of о̀но (it))
  3. of them (clitic genitive plural of о̀на (she))
  4. them (clitic accusative plural of о̑н (he))
  5. them (clitic accusative plural of о̀но (it))
  6. them (clitic accusative plural of о̀на (she))
